Stone House is a charming 400 year old cottage in a beautiful rural setting, just a short drive from Leominster. Boasting endless character throughout, the cottage has been lovingly restored to offer guests all the modern comforts you would expect in a luxury hotel, whilst retaining its historic ambience of a traditional home. Once the local stonemasons abode and workshop, Stone House has been transformed into a stunning holiday home for all seasons with all the character and charm of a bygone era, seamlessly blending with all the modern comforts you could wish for today. The original wooden vertical beams have been exposed to create a stunning partition wall that will take your breath away as you walk into the flagstone floored entrance hall which is central to all the cottage has to offer. The open-plan sitting and dining area is dominated by a traditional inglenook fire place, with a wood burning stove and two large sumptuous sofas, making it the perfect place to spend those cosy winter evenings. To the rear of the room is the dining area with a large table seating six and a beautiful handcrafted window seat with views across the garden. The bespoke fitted kitchen has been well-equipped to allow even the keenest chef to prepare those special meals for friends and family and leads through to the well-equipped boot room and back door of the cottage. Across the hallway you will find a tastefully furnished snug with enough sofas and armchairs for everyone to gather round the large wall-mounted Smart television. The ground floor shower room consists of a walk-in shower and a separate utility room with sink, washing machine and a traditional wooden pulley system clothes airer. A beautiful oak staircase leads up to the three well appointed bedrooms. Each has been individually furnished with beautiful fabrics and antique chairs to provide a tranquil and calm sleeping environment. Each room has wonderful views across the surrounding countryside and plenty of natural light comes through the traditional solid wood windows. There is also a family bathroom on this floor with a full length bath, ideal for a relaxing soak after a day exploring. Attention to detail throughout this wonderful cottage ensures that you will want for nothing during your stay and the outside space is no different. To the front of the cottage next to the original stone cider press is a large solid wood table and chairs, ideal for alfresco dining or evening drinks. To the side of the house looking out to the Herefordshire hills is a large patio area with an overhead triangular sail providing shade whilst you relax on the outdoor sofa or cook up a feast on the pizza oven. Nature lovers can enjoy the wide variety of birds that come into the garden every day and you are encouraged to take your morning coffee out to one of the garden seats and surround yourself in the magnificent birdsong. The small field opposite is home to some handsome rare breed sheep and if you are lucky you may spot a deer venturing down from the hills to wander into the garden. Stone House is ideally placed for walking, cycling and touring the Welsh Marches. There are 120 acres of common land on the doorstep which affords amazing views and is home to many species of birds and wildlife.
The market towns of Leominster, Ludlow, Ledbury and Hay-on-Wye are all easily reached and are full of wonderful old buildings, lovely independent shops and great restaurants and cafés. The county town of Hereford is ten miles away, it's jewel in the crown, the cathedral with its famous Mappa Mundi exhibition. Hereford is located on the River Wye which also offers many opportunities for canoeing enthusiasts.
There are many superb places to dine out including The Cider Barn at Pembridge, The Nags Head at Canon Pyon, The Angel at Kingsland and The Riverside at Aymestry.
The county is famous for its stunning half-timbered houses and boasts a Black and White Village Trail. Equally famous for its cider, there are many local producers that sell at the farm gate.
The area has many fabulous gardens to visit, along with historic houses and National Trust properties. Being on the Welsh border there are many castles to visit which make for a great day out.
In the opposite direction can be found the stunning Malvern Hills, offering superb walks and views.
For younger guests, there are many exciting things to do without having to drive too far, including crazy golf and ten pin bowling at The Grove, a full range of outdoor activities at Oaker Wood and a fabulous Go Karting track at Hereford Raceway near Weobley. Hereford also has several options for indoor climbing; Green Spider Climbing, Boulder Barn and Hereford Climbing Centre. Soft play activities can be found in Hereford at Flip Out and Play Planet.
